8e51029c614f7375debb0c95ab40e1c754cd0cb468e047defacaf432088a3fba

966197 (913 blocks ago)

237577414

⏴ Block 966196 (127e57cf...648) | Block 966198 ⏵ | Latest block ⏭

Metadata

28/1/26, 12:26 pm UTC (1d 6:26:54 ago) 23.0 1.15kB (1.15kB block + 0B txs) Pulse 💓 19.463 SENT

Transactions (0)

Show raw details